The Royal Romance: Charles and Diana
Kicking off our list with a real-life fairytale, we have Prince Charles and Lady Diana Spencer. Their wedding in 1981 was a global event, watched by an estimated 750 million people. Diana, with her stunning beauty and warmth, captured the hearts of the world, and her style set trends that still influence fashion today.
The couple seemed like a match made in heaven, but as we all know, their story was far from a fairytale ending. Despite their high-profile divorce in 1996, their love story remains one of the most talked-about in history. Diana's tragic death in 1997 left the world mourning, and her legacy as a fashion icon and humanitarian lives on.

The Power Couple: Madonna and Sean Penn
Madonna and Sean Penn were the ultimate '80s power couple. They were both at the peak of their careers when they tied the knot in 1985 - Madonna was just starting her reign as the Queen of Pop, and Sean was a rising star in Hollywood. Their relationship was as tumultuous as it was passionate, with the couple making headlines for their dramatic public fights and reconciliations.
Despite their rocky relationship, Madonna and Sean's love story was one for the books. They inspired countless songs and tabloid headlines, and their influence on popular culture is still felt today.
